Fossil fuels, such as coal, oil, and natural gas, were formed over thousands of years from the remains of plants and other organisms. When these fossil fuels are burned, they release stored energy in the form of heat, which is used for electricity generation, transportation, and heating.

Take your car for example. You put gas in your car, and your engine burns the fuel and converts the potential energy of the fossil fuel into heat energy, and the heat energy into kenetic energy, and your car goes. Chemical energy is stored in fossil fuels, resulting from the organic matter that underwent decomposition over millions of years. This energy is released when the fossil fuels are burned or combusted.
The chemical energy stored in fossil fuels is converted to thermal energy when they are burned. This process releases heat energy, which can be harnessed for various applications such as electricity generation or heating.
